LetrixZ / faccina

Archive reader
43 stars 6 forks source link

Connecting to an account ? more ideas~ #23

Closed HeartBtz closed 9 hours ago

HeartBtz commented 6 days ago

Hi :)

First of all, is it normal that account management doesn't work yet? Or is it only on my instance?

Then I have a few ideas for you when the accounts will be operational: -Do you plan to create a kind of reading history? (for example, we'll know where we are in our reading e.g. page135/345) as well as a history of what we've already read? -What about bookmarking projects for later reading? -A choice of the number of doujins per page would be a good thing :) -The possibility of making collections, even if it goes back to the idea of bookmarking.

beyond that, thank you for your work, it's very nice, and quite useful to me!

LetrixZ commented 6 days ago

Hi.

There isn't any account managment yet as I still need to define what to show, aside from password and email.

The reading history is a good idea. I'll also see to add a page limit setting.

I'm planning on adding user collections. That would solve the bookmarks.

HeartBtz commented 6 days ago

I'm waiting for it ! don't hesitate to send me testing environments :)

Small detail, even if it's not important, there's a bug in BUN. It has trouble reading archives when these are on a partition (linux) other than the executable. This leads to problems when scanning resources. To bypass this, I had to create a 1TB virtual disk on my proxmox, and that's pretty impractical I must admit haha, I'd have preferred to be able to mount NFS, but Bun doesn't support it very well, sad! https://github.com/oven-sh/bun/issues/7412

I'll let you know about any bugs I see as soon as I find them, don't hesitate :)

LetrixZ commented 6 days ago

On macOS, I'm using a NFS mount for the content directory. Didn't try SMB yet.

I'll try that later.

HeartBtz commented 6 days ago

During my tests, I was indeed on an NFS mount on my Debian. As soon as I changed the source of my archives, the problem was solved.

LetrixZ commented 15 hours ago

Added configuration for page limit options and user collections to the lastest version.

Now I'm working on the reading history.

HeartBtz commented 15 hours ago

Thanks a lot !! :D

LetrixZ commented 9 hours ago

Reading history is done. I'll add a way to remove from history later and maybe add toggle to disable it as an user.